Vehicle Factory Jabalpur was started in 1969 to take up production of Shaktiman 3T (in collaboration with MAN, Germany), Nissan 1T & Jonga (in collaboration with NISSAN MOTORS Co., Japan). The Factory area is spread over 330 acres and estate 600 acres.
Vehicle Factory, Jabalpur, established in 1969, is a dedicated manufacturing unit to meet 'Transport Needs' of the Armed Forces. It is ISO 9001-2000 certified with NABL-certified laboratories and State-of-the-Art CNC machines for manufacturing Transmission Components, Fabricated Items, Chassis Frames, Vehicle Assembly Lines, and more.
VFJ manufactures various vehicles, including Armoured Light Vehicles, Military Transport Vehicles, and Variants like Water Bowsers, Kitchen Containers, and Recovery Vehicles. VFJ also has capabilities for Plasma Cutting, Laser Cutting, Armour Welding, and Vehicle Assembly.
